Transaction 769636fef100923fea9ef1ae6eba1fcf6b63ba6a1efb0381a147fbd2dea21b4d
1 Input
1 Output
-
769636fef100923fea9ef1ae6eba1fcf6b63ba6a1efb0381a147fbd2dea21b4d:0
- value
- 654072
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76ab7353ad7343fe5bd13a80e4efc5ace5e1150c OP_EQUAL
- address
- 3CWV3mZE861yAzvSJw6fopvzze5MdasjqV